There will probably be no more firmware updates for the Clip+. if you want more settings, much better on the go playlists, a much better equilizer, and crossfeed, there is the the free alternative firmware(operating system for the player) Rockbox. In case you don’t know what crossfeed is, it mixes some of the alternative channel with a slight delay, making headphone listening much more like speaker listening, where each ear hears both music channels. This is adjustable, or can be turned off. The downsides to Rockbox is that it doesn’t support protected files, and it might permanently impair the player’s ability to play some protected files.

Rockbox is installed as a dual boot OS, so the original Sandisk firmware(OS) is still available, and can be booted into by holding down the left button on startup of a Rockboxed Clip+. Rockbox also gives you choices to customize the screen. If you are curious about Rockbox, check out the Rockbox manual for the Clip+. My Clip+ and Clip Zip have been Rockboxed. Rockbox is great for those who listen to podcasts, as it has variable speed playback with pitch correction. This is good for listening to slow speakers at around 1.4x or 1.5x the normal speed.

Rockbox for the Clip+ has 110 themes, or 110 choices for how and what is displayed on the screen.
